I've talked with/written about several hybridizers who have spoken at my local club (www.dssew.org) and most of them indicate that a plant should be grown a minimum of five years to see how it performs. Especially if you divide it, you want to see if it will survive. I'd try and be patient and line it out to see how it does before registering. Did you hybridize this one yourself or did you purchase seeds? As a side note, blooms can vary within the first few years, if you've had it only a couple years it may possibly look different next season.
